What famio is and why you might want to cancel

Famio (also called MyFamio) is a family-tracking and location-sharing app designed to help you monitor loved ones and set up safety notifications. The service runs on a freemium model: you get basic features for free, but unlock advanced monitoring, alerts, and real-time tracking through paid premium subscriptions. Whether you subscribed through Apple's App Store, Google Play, or directly via Famio's website, understanding exactly how you paid matters because your cancellation route depends on it. At Stopee, we help thousands of Canadians navigate these billing channels every month, and we know that confusion over where your money goes leads to accidental renewals and wasted dollars.

If you've decided Famio isn't serving your family's needs anymore, or if the cost no longer fits your budget, cancelling promptly protects you from unexpected charges. The challenge is that Famio uses three separate billing systems, and each one requires a different cancellation method. This guide walks you through every option, explains what happens after you cancel, and shows you exactly what consumer rights you have in Canada.

Your consumer rights in canada and what protection applies to famio

Canada's consumer protection framework for digital goods rests on federal and provincial legislation, though many digital services operate in a legal grey area. At the federal level, the Competition Act protects you from deceptive marketing and hidden fees. Provincially, most provinces (including Ontario, British Columbia, and Quebec) have consumer protection laws that grant you a statutory withdrawal right, typically between 7 and 14 days from purchase, for digital services - but this right often does not apply once you've already received the service. Famio does not publicly advertise a company-wide 14-day refund policy, which means you cannot rely on statutory protections alone.

However, if you were charged during a free trial without explicit consent, or if the subscription was purchased by someone else on your device, you have stronger grounds for a refund. If Famio refuses to help, you can escalate to your provincial consumer protection authority or file a chargeback through your credit card company. Stopee's research shows that many Canadians successfully recover unauthorized charges through chargeback processes when companies don't respond to refund requests. Always keep your receipt email and document all communication with Famio's support team - this evidence becomes critical if you need to escalate.

How to cancel famio across all billing platforms

Your cancellation method depends entirely on how you originally paid for the subscription.

Cancel famio if you subscribed through apple's app store

If your subscription appears in your Apple ID account settings, follow these steps to cancel auto-renewal.

  1. Open Settings on your iPhone or iPad.
  2. Tap your name at the top of the screen.
  3. Select Subscriptions.
  4. Find and tap Famio in the list.
  5. Tap Cancel Subscription at the bottom of the screen.
  6. Choose your reason for cancelling (optional but helpful for Apple's feedback loop).
  7. Confirm the cancellation by tapping the red Cancel Subscription button.
  8. Apple will display a confirmation message. Take a screenshot for your records.

Pro tip: After you tap Cancel Subscription, you'll see a summary showing the exact date your access ends. Write down this date - you can still use premium features until then, and you won't be charged after.

Warning: If Famio does not appear in your Subscriptions list, your subscription may have been created directly through Famio's website, not through Apple. In that case, skip to the web cancellation method below.

Warning: Deleting the Famio app from your phone does not cancel the subscription. You must cancel through Settings or the subscription will continue to renew and charge your Apple ID.

Cancel famio if you subscribed through google play

If you purchased your subscription on an Android device, your billing is managed by Google Play.

  1. Open the Google Play Store app on your Android phone or tablet.
  2. Tap your profile icon in the top-right corner.
  3. Select Manage subscriptions.
  4. Tap Famio.
  5. Tap Cancel subscription at the bottom.
  6. Select a cancellation reason (optional).
  7. Confirm by tapping Cancel subscription again.
  8. Google Play will send a confirmation email to your account. Check your inbox to verify.

Pro tip: Google Play shows your current billing cycle end date on the subscription details page. Note this date - your premium access stops after this date passes.

Warning: Like Apple, deleting the app does not stop the subscription. Cancellation only happens through the Google Play Store settings.

Cancel famio if you subscribed directly through the web

If you signed up for Famio through their website (myfamio.com or similar) and the subscription never appears in Apple or Google settings, your payment is billed directly by Famio.

  1. Visit Famio's website and log into your account using your email and password.
  2. Look for a Subscriptions, Billing, or Account Settings tab in your profile menu.
  3. Find the active Famio subscription in the list.
  4. Look for a button or link labeled Turn Off Auto-Renewal, Cancel Subscription, or similar.
  5. Click it and follow the on-screen confirmation steps.
  6. Take a screenshot of the confirmation screen showing your cancellation was processed.

Pro tip: If you cannot locate the subscription settings on Famio's website, email their support team at support@myfamio.com and request cancellation explicitly. Include your account email address and ask for written confirmation of the cancellation date.

Warning: Famio's website navigation can be unclear. If you get stuck, do not abandon the process - contact support immediately. The longer you wait, the closer you get to your next renewal charge.

If you are unsure which platform billed you

Check your payment history to identify the billing source, then follow the corresponding cancellation steps above.

  • Check your email for receipt emails from Apple (mentions "Apple ID"), Google (mentions "Google Play"), or Famio (mentions "MyFamio" or "Famio support").
  • Log into your Apple ID account settings and view purchase history.
  • Log into your Google account and check your payment methods and transactions.
  • Log into your Famio web account and look for a Billing or Invoice history section.
  • Once you identify the correct platform, follow the cancellation method for that platform.

What happens immediately after you cancel famio

Cancelling auto-renewal does not kick you off the service right away - instead, you retain access to premium features until your current billing period expires. If you paid for a monthly subscription and cancelled mid-cycle, you keep the full month. This means you lose nothing by cancelling early. Your Famio account and user profile remain active unless you explicitly request account deletion, so your family safety settings, contact lists, and location history are preserved. You can still log in and view your data even after the paid period ends and you revert to free features.

Pro tip: If you want to fully delete your Famio account and all associated data, contact support@myfamio.com separately and request account deletion. This is different from subscription cancellation and requires an additional step.

Will you get a refund when you cancel famio

Famio does not publish a clear, company-wide refund policy. Refund outcomes vary based on how you paid and your circumstances.

Refunds through apple or google

If you subscribed through the App Store or Google Play, those platforms handle refunds independently of Famio. Apple and Google typically grant refunds within 15 days of purchase if you request them through your account settings. After 15 days, refunds become discretionary. Contact Apple Support or Google Play Support directly if you want a refund - Famio cannot override these decisions.

Refunds requested directly from famio

Customer reports suggest Famio handles refunds on a case-by-case basis. Some users report receiving full refunds after contacting support@myfamio.com, particularly if they were charged during a free trial without proper consent. Others report slow responses or outright refusals, especially if the trial or billing period has already ended. There is no guaranteed timeline or outcome. If you want to request a refund, act quickly (within days of the charge, not weeks) and email support with clear documentation of why the charge was unauthorized or unwanted.

Pro tip: If Famio refuses a refund and you used a credit card, file a chargeback through your credit card company. Chargebacks are a consumer protection tool available to you, and they often succeed when companies fail to provide refunds after requesting them. Common mistakes to avoid when cancelling famio

Many people cancel incorrectly and end up charged again, or they assume cancellation happened when it didn't. We've seen these mistakes cost Canadians hundreds of dollars in accidental renewals.

Mistake 1: deleting the app instead of cancelling the subscription

Deleting the Famio app from your phone does absolutely nothing to stop billing. The subscription lives in Apple's, Google's, or Famio's server, not on your device. Removing the app from your home screen and deleting it are not the same as cancelling auto-renewal. You must follow the platform-specific cancellation steps outlined above. If you delete the app without cancelling first, you will continue to be charged monthly until you cancel through the proper channel.

Mistake 2: confusing free trial cancellation with subscription cancellation

Famio sometimes offers free trials. Cancelling the free trial does not automatically cancel the paid subscription that begins after the trial ends. You must separately cancel the recurring subscription. Check your subscription settings carefully to confirm you've cancelled both the trial and any auto-renewing plan.

Mistake 3: not confirming cancellation in writing

If you cancel directly through Apple or Google, take a screenshot of the confirmation screen. If you cancel via web or email, save the confirmation email. Without proof, you have no evidence if Famio or the platform disputes the cancellation. Documentation protects you in disputes and is essential for chargebacks.

Mistake 4: cancelling one subscription method but not realizing you have another

It's possible (though rare) to have two active Famio subscriptions if you originally signed up through your web account, then later subscribed again through Google Play. You must cancel both. Check all three platforms (Apple, Google, web) to ensure you have no active subscriptions across any channel.
